WebMar 2, 2024 · This report discusses what the House of Lords does, summarises successful and unsuccessful proposals for reform in the past, explores public opinion about the House of Lords, and discusses what the key reform objectives and priorities should be. It also considers what experience from other bicameral (two chamber) parliaments can teach us. WebMar 3, 2024 · The House of Lords is being undermined by uncontrolled prime ministerial appointments and the chamber’s growing size, plus continued membership of hereditary peers – and “urgent” change in these areas is needed before more ambitious reform is attempted.. WebThe House of Lords Act in 1999 severely diminished the roles and member of the Lords and only allowed some 92 hereditary peers to remain in the House. The Stage 1 reform is committed to continuing the transformation and ultimately getting rid of the remaining 92 hereditary peers. This brings to the point of the House of Lords reform bill that ... WebAug 26, 2009 · The House of Commons voted in favour of reforms leading to a 100% or 80% elected second chamber and against all other options. The Lords took a different view – rejecting election – but given ...
